Quality requirements for materials used in the construction of environmentally friendly lime kilns
The stable operation and long-term service life of environmentally friendly lime kilns are based on the quality of materials used in the construction process. The quality of materials is directly related to the structural safety, insulation performance, operational efficiency, and pollutant emission control level of the kiln body, therefore strict quality standards must be established.
Refractory materials are the core of kiln lining, and their quality is crucial. High alumina bricks or magnesia alumina spinel bricks with high refractoriness, good thermal stability, and high strength must be selected to withstand the high-temperature chemical erosion and material scouring during the limestone decomposition stage. The insulation layer material should choose ceramic fiber blankets or lightweight insulation bricks with low thermal conductivity and good insulation performance to reduce kiln heat loss and improve thermal efficiency. The plates and profiles used in the steel structure of the kiln shell must comply with the design requirements of the grade and specifications, have qualified strength and heat resistance, and ensure the stability of the overall structure.
The selection of sealing materials directly affects the airtightness and environmental indicators of the kiln body. High temperature resistant sealing materials must be used at the connections of kiln doors, observation holes, etc. to ensure that the air leakage rate is maintained at a low level during operation. This is crucial for controlling excessive air coefficient, reducing energy consumption, and ensuring the calcination atmosphere. Various types of conveying pipelines, valves, and their refractory lining also need to have good wear and corrosion resistance to adapt to long-term operating conditions.
Before all materials enter the site, their material certificates, factory qualification certificates, and third-party testing reports must be checked. If necessary, sampling and retesting must be conducted to ensure that their various performance indicators fully meet the design and industry standard requirements.
